JavaScript特效大全:从简单脚本到复杂应用
151 浏览量
更新于2024-09-01
收藏 156KB PDF 举报
"JavaScript经典效果集锦,包含各种实用脚本、提示信息、滚动图片、键盘指令响应、文本链接动画、树型菜单、分页、动态浮动层、视频播放器等,适合网页开发者参考和使用。"
这篇摘要提及的是一个JavaScript效果合集,包括众多实用的网页交互功能和视觉效果。以下是一些主要知识点的详细说明:
1. **小脚本代码**:例如自动播放音频、页面自动最大化和实时显示时间,这些都是提升用户体验的常见功能。
- 自动播放音频:通过`<embed>`标签嵌入音频资源,设置`hidden`、`autostart`和`loop`属性实现自动播放和循环。
- 页面自动最大化:利用JavaScript调整浏览器窗口大小至屏幕可用区域,提供全屏体验。
- 实时时间显示:JavaScript可以通过`Date`对象获取当前时间,并动态更新页面元素显示。
2. **鼠标提示信息**:类似于163登录后的提示,通过事件监听和DOM操作实现,提高用户对链接或按钮信息的感知。
3. **文字截断**:当文本过长时,使用CSS和JavaScript组合实现省略号显示,保持页面整洁。
4. **滚动图片**:通过定时器和CSS动画实现图片的动态切换,增加视觉吸引力。
5. **键盘指令响应**:监听键盘事件,允许用户通过键盘快捷键触发特定功能,提升交互性。
6. **文本链接动画**:使用CSS和JavaScript实现链接的渐隐渐显,增强用户体验。
7. **树型菜单**:模仿QQ的好友/黑名单列表,通过JavaScript动态构建和展开收缩菜单结构。
8. **翻页功能**:对于长内容,分页显示是必要的,JavaScript可以轻松实现动态加载和切换页面。
9. **透明层**:使用CSS实现透明度控制,用于创建遮罩层或浮动窗口。
10. **HTML页面生成**:从JSP动态生成HTML或其他格式的页面,方便内容的静态化和分享。
11. **表单验证**:使用JavaScript进行前端验证,提高数据质量和用户体验。
12. **脚本日历**:提供用户友好的日期选择界面,常见于表单中的日期输入。
13. **进入/退出页面效果**:利用JavaScript实现页面加载和卸载时的动画或提示。
14. **表格高亮**:选中表格单元格时改变颜色,提供反馈。
15. **弹出提示**:创建提示框或气泡提示,传达信息或警告。
16. **图片切换**:图片轮播效果,常用于展示产品或广告。
17. **圆边圆角**:使用CSS3实现元素的圆角效果,增加设计感。
18. **跳动菜单**:动态菜单,吸引用户注意力。
19. **页面抓取**:可能涉及AJAX或Web scraping技术,获取并显示远程内容。
20. **分页**:客户端的分页处理,无需服务器端交互。
21. **个性化页面**:允许用户定制布局或功能,提升用户参与度。
22. **美化表格**:通过CSS样式提升表格的视觉效果。
23. **可拖动浮动层**:带有阴影效果的浮动层,允许用户自由移动。
24. **代码运行环境**:在线代码编辑和运行工具,方便开发者测试和学习。
25. **凹陷文字**:使用CSS3创建3D效果的文本。
26. **仿Flash菜单**:使用JavaScript和CSS实现类似Flash的动态效果。
27. **自定义容器和字体大小**:允许用户调整界面元素的尺寸,满足不同需求。
28. **REAL视频播放器**:集成视频播放功能,支持特定格式。
29. **快捷键提交**:通过键盘快捷键直接提交表单,提高效率。
30. **accesskey**:使用accesskey属性实现快捷访问链接。
31. **图片切换+描述**:结合文字描述的图片切换效果。
32. **菜单特效**:丰富多样的菜单动画效果。
33. **CSS和JS下拉菜单**:创建响应式的下拉菜单,增强导航体验。
这些JavaScript经典效果涵盖了网页开发的多个方面,不仅增加了页面的互动性,也提高了用户的浏览体验。开发者可以根据需求选择合适的效果应用到自己的项目中。
点击了解资源详情
点击了解资源详情
点击了解资源详情
2011-03-30 上传
128 浏览量
2009-05-17 上传
2008-12-31 上传
weixin_38530415
- 粉丝: 4
- 资源: 940
最新资源
- 俄罗斯RTSD数据集实现交通标志实时检测
- 易语言开发的文件批量改名工具使用Ex_Dui美化界面
- 爱心援助动态网页教程:前端开发实战指南
- 复旦微电子数字电路课件4章同步时序电路详解
- Dylan Manley的编程投资组合登录页面设计介绍
- Python实现H3K4me3与H3K27ac表观遗传标记域长度分析
- 易语言开源播放器项目:简易界面与强大的音频支持
- 介绍rxtx2.2全系统环境下的Java版本使用
- ZStack-CC2530 半开源协议栈使用与安装指南
- 易语言实现的八斗平台与淘宝评论采集软件开发
- Christiano响应式网站项目设计与技术特点
- QT图形框架中QGraphicRectItem的插入与缩放技术
- 组合逻辑电路深入解析与习题教程
- Vue+ECharts实现中国地图3D展示与交互功能
- MiSTer_MAME_SCRIPTS:自动下载MAME与HBMAME脚本指南
- 前端技术精髓:构建响应式盆栽展示网站